The renewal of our three-year agreement with Torvane Materials has been assessed in detail. Proposed terms include a 4.2% unit-price increase, partially offset by improved volume rebates and extended payment terms of sixty days. Sensitivity analysis indicates a net annual cost impact of under 1% on the Meridia product line, assuming stable demand. Legal has flagged no material changes to liability clauses. We recommend approval, subject to the conditions outlined in the confidential note below.

confidential, yawip-bahif: Zorokox Partners plans to lower the Casax list price by 28.0 percent in April. The board signed off on a budget of $271.0 million for Project Juldor. The renewal with Pelokox Partners closes at $410.1 million a year, 3.4 percent below the last contract. Project Pelok slips by a full year because of the audit delay.

**Step 4 — Patch the image cache leak**

Quick one: Pixelbarn's thumbnail cache leaks memory when eviction stalls under load. The fix ships in `cachefix-2.1`. Pull the branch, rebuild the `thumbsvc` container, and redeploy to the canary pool first. Watch RSS on the canary for ten minutes — flat line means you're good. To push the patched image, you'll need the deploy key shown below.

rollout seal: bky9_PeXH1fTLY

## v2.8.0 — Changed defaults

Heads up: the Pebbleview metrics sidecar now flushes every 15s instead of 60s, and the default aggregation window shrank to match. We kept getting paged for stale dashboards, so this should make graphs feel less laggy without hammering the collector. If you pinned the old defaults anywhere, double-check before the rollout train leaves Thursday. Nothing else in the sidecar changed this release. The full set of new defaults is listed below.

settings of fafog-haduf:
ZORIX_PIN=4648
ZORIX_METRICS_HOST=metrics.zorix.paliqsys.corp
ZORIX_LOG_LEVEL=info
ZORIX_TENANT=druix

# Env Vars — Routewren Driver Assignment

The heuristic service reads all tuning knobs from the env file: max pickup radius, idle-driver weight, and surge decay. Defaults are fine for local dev. The scorer also calls the telemetry service on every assignment cycle and needs its service key, which is set on the line below.

secret setting of fahap-bajeg: ARCHIVE_KEY3=f00